Effect of Ambient Noise on the Responses to Meal Ingestion
NCT03827707 · Status: COMPLETED · Phase: NA · Type: INTERVENTIONAL · Enrollment: 12
Last updated 2019-03-22
Summary
Meal ingestion induces sensations that are influenced by a series of conditioning factors. Aim: to determine the effect of ambient noise on the sensory responses to a standard probe meal. Randomized, cross-over study in healthy subjects comparing the effect of ambient noise versus silence on the sensations induced by a probe meal. Participants (12 men) will be instructed to eat a standard dinner the day before, to consume a standard breakfast at home after overnight fast, and to report to the laboratory, where the test meal will be administered 5 h after breakfast. Studies will be conducted in a quiet, isolated room with participants sitting on a chair. One study day, a noise will applied via headphones for 60 min after meal ingestion and the other day headphones without sound will applied. Perception of homeostatic sensations (hunger/ satiation, fullness) and hedonic sensations (digestive well-being, mood) will be measured at 5 min intervals 10 min before and 20 min after ingestion and at 10 min intervals up to 60 min after the probe meal.
